What tests are done to diagnose autoimmune disease Autoimmune diseases are complex conditions where the body’s immune system mistakenly targets its own tissues, leading to inflammation, tissue damage, and various symptoms depending on the organs involved. Diagnosing these diseases can be challenging because their symptoms often mimic other conditions. To establish an accurate diagnosis, healthcare providers rely on a combination of clinical evaluations and specialized laboratory tests designed to detect signs of immune system dysregulation.

One of the primary tools used in diagnosing autoimmune diseases is blood tests. These tests help identify specific markers that suggest the immune system is attacking the body’s own tissues. For instance, the presence of antinuclear antibodies (ANA) is commonly tested when autoimmune diseases like lupus are suspected. ANA are autoantibodies that target cell nuclei, and a positive result indicates immune activity against nuclear components, although it is not specific to lupus alone. Further testing for specific autoantibodies can help narrow down the diagnosis; for example, anti-dsDNA and anti-Smith antibodies are more specific for systemic lupus erythematosus, while anti-CCP antibodies are associated with rheumatoid arthritis.

Complement levels, such as C3 and C4, are also measured because these proteins are part of the immune system and tend to be consumed during active autoimmune processes. Low complement levels can indicate ongoing immune-mediated tissue damage. Rheumatoid factor (RF) and anti-cyclic citrullinated peptide (anti-CCP) antibodies are particularly useful in diagnosing rheumatoid arthritis, especially when joint symptoms are present. Erythrocyte sedimentation rate (ESR) and C-reactive protein (CRP) are nonspecific markers of inflammation that can support the suspicion of an autoimmune process when elevated.

Beyond blood tests, other diagnostic procedures may be employed depending on the suspected disease. For example, in cases of suspected autoimmune thyroiditis, thyroid function tests measuring TSH, T3, and T4 levels are performed. When joint involvement is prominent, imaging techniques such as X-rays or MRI scans can reveal characteristic joint damage or inflammation. A biopsy of affected tissues, like skin or kidney tissue, might be necessary to confirm the diagnosis, especially in complex cases where blood tests do not provide definitive answers.

In addition to these tests, physicians often perform comprehensive clinical evaluations, including detailed medical histories and physical examinations, to correlate laboratory findings with symptoms. The diagnosis of autoimmune diseases is usually a process of integrating all these pieces of information, as no single test can definitively diagnose most autoimmune conditions.

In summary, diagnosing autoimmune diseases involves a series of blood tests to detect specific autoantibodies and markers of inflammation, complemented by imaging studies and tissue biopsies if needed. This multi-faceted approach enables clinicians to accurately identify and differentiate among the many autoimmune disorders, proving essential for guiding appropriate treatment strategies.
